ECON EXAM QUESTIONS AND ANSWERS

Which of the following examples represents the relationship between division of labor
and production? - Answers - A nurse takes patients' vital signs while the doctor
focuses on diagnosis so that more patients can receive care

Scarcity is a problem because... - Answers - There are not enough resources to
produce all the goods and services people want to purchase.

Which of the following statements describes microeconomics? - Answers - The price of
beef increased by 15% last month due to a cyber attack on a major beef processing
firm.

Someone criticizes the government for increasing interest rates but approving the
increase in government spending. They are criticizing the government's ____policy and
praising the government ___ policy. - Answers - Monetary, Fiscal

The circular flow diagram describes... - Answers - How firms and households carry out
economic activities through the market for input or factors of production and the market
for goods and services.

A good economic theory .... - Answers - captures the essence of the economic
concepts and facilitates their understanding.

According to the circular flow diagram, households... - Answers - Are sellers in the
labor market and buyers in the goods and services market.

In market economies, most decisions are made by ___, while in command economies,
most economic decisions are made by ___. - Answers - Private citizens and firms; the
government

Gross Domestic Product represents... - Answers - The value of the total production in
a country

Which of the following elements demonstrate the degree of globalization? - Answers -
High levels of trade and exchange between countries.

The formal study of economics began when Adam Smith (1723-1790) published his
famous book The Wealth of Nations in 1776. In the first chapter of The Wealth of
Nations, Smith introduces the idea of the division of labor. Define "division of labor" and
illustrate with an example.
Your Answer:
The division of labor is an effective economic system for workers and firms to produce
products at a faster and higher quality.

An example of division of labor is: building a computer.
Building a computer takes multiple tasks to complete. There is the motherboard, the
ram, the graphics card, the cpu, and the casing. Creating a a computer all together
would take for ever to finish. There needs to be separate divisions of labor where
workers specialize in making each individual piece to the computer otherwise the rate of
production we be so low that a business couldn't thrive. - Answers -
